NHL News: Bruins, Wings, Panthers, Preds, Rangers, Sens, Blues, Lightning, Leafs and Caps

On the Boston Bruins …

Boston Bruins: The Bruins signed Karson Kuhlman to a two-year entry-level contract.

Fluto Shinzawa: Forward Riley Nash didn’t skate yesterday and he’s not looking good for Game 1.

On the Detroit Red Wings …

Dana Wakiji: Red Wings GM Ken Holland said that coach Jeff Blashill will be back next year.

Helene St. James: GM Holland on 2017 first-round pick Michael Rasmussen: “We are going to give (Michael) Rasmussen a chance to be on the team next year.”

Ted Kulfan: Defenseman Niklas Kronwall expects to play next season if his health remains good.

Helene St. James: Krowall said that he can’t see why Henrik Zetterberg wouldn’t play next year as long as his back can hold up.

On the Florida Panthers …

Matthew DeFranks: Goaltender Roberto Luongo said for sure that he’ll be back next year and is hoping to play 50-60 games

On the Nashville Predators …

Brooks Bratten: Both Calle Jarnkrok and Yannick Weber (upper-body for both) practiced again yesterday.

On the New York Rangers …

Dan Rosen: Goaltender Henrik Lundqvist said that he had been dealing with a knee injury all year that was likely related an issue he had at the World Championship last year. Lundqvist added that it didn’t affect how he played. He’ll meet with doctors in the next few days.

Rick Carpiniello: Lundqvist will have an MRI and may need some work on his knee injury.

On the Ottawa Senators …

Brent Wallace: Eugene Melnyk when asked if there were any circumstances that he’d sell the team: “..there is no price. if something is not for sale, it’s not for sale.”

Ian Mendes: “One thing that is crystal clear from tonight: There is a complete lack of trust and respect from the Sens organization towards the mainstream media who cover them on a daily basis. Organization believes we misreported and blew several things out of proportion.”

John Rodenburg: (going off of Mendes’ tweet) “I will also say on behalf of @TSN1200, we have asked for interviews with Pierre Dorion and Eugene Melnyk frequently thru-out the last half of the season. That would be their opportunity to ‘set the record straight’. None of those asks were answered.”

Sens Communications: The Senators reassigned forwards Filip Chlapik and Colin White to the AHL.

On the St. Louis Blues …

Lou Korac: Defenseman Robert Bortuzzo has a left MCL injury. He doesn’t require surgery and just rest should be good.

Lou Korac: Sounding like the Blues will give Robert Thomas a good shot at making the team next year.

On the Tampa Bay Lightning …

Bryan Burns: Coach Jon Cooper on having playoff experience: “What I like about our group is we’ve had a lot of guys that have played in the Cup Final and as recently as a few years ago and I think they’re all playing with that chip on their shoulder.”

On the Toronto Maple Leafs …

Lance Hornby: The Marlies added draft pick Carl Grundstrom from Sweden for their playoffs, and signed draft pick goaltender Ian Scott to an ATO.

On the Washington Capitals …

Tom Gulitti: Coach Barry Trotz said that Philipp Grubauer will start Game 1 but it would be game-by-game after that.

Isabelle Khurshudyan: Trotz on starting Grubauer: “I just think that Grubi deserves the opportunity. I think the body of work, especially this year, presented itself. Trust me, it wasn’t an easy decision. I put a lot of factors in. Braden has been the guy for a long time.”

Offer Sheet Compensation

<$1.54M no comp
$1.54M – $2.34M: 3rd
$2.34M – $4.68M: 2nd
$4.68M – $7.02M: 1st, 3rd
$7.02M – $9.36M: 1st, 2nd, 3rd
$9.36M – $11.7M: 1st, 1st, 2nd, 3rd
$11.7M+: 1st, 1st, 1st, 1st,
